Creatine might aid improve the stamina of individuals with muscular dystrophy. A review of 14 research studies, published in 2013, discovered that people with muscular dystrophy that took creatine experienced a rise in muscular tissue toughness of 8.5 percent compared to those who did not take the supplement."Short- and medium-term creatine treatment improves muscle strength in people with muscular dystrophies and is well-tolerated."Dr.

In mouse versions of Parkinson's illness, creatine had the ability to avoid the loss of cells that are generally affected by the condition. An animal study involving a mixed therapy of coenzyme Q( 10) and creatine that this could help deal with neurodegenerative diseases such as Parkinson's illness and Huntington's illness. Nonetheless, study released in JAMA, with over 1,700 human participants, that: "Therapy with creatine monohydrate for at the very least 5 years, compared to sugar pill did not boost clinical outcomes."Similarly, an organized review released in Cochrane that there was no strong evidence for making use of creatine in Parkinson's.

People in the U.S. are believed to spend some $2.7 billion a year on sporting activities supplements, a lot of which have creatine. The International Olympic Board (IOC) and the National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A) enable the use of creatine, and it is extensively made use of amongst professional athletes. In the past, the NCAA permitted member institutions and universities to offer creatine to students with institution funds, however this is no more permitted.

It's stored in skeletal muscle mass and help in the resynthesis of adenosine triphosphate (or ATP), which offers power for temporary, maximum-effort muscular tissue tightenings. It's this procedure that offers Rodonis the additional boost he needs for cranking out those last challenging reps. "Creatine can be made use of as an energy resource for the highest-intensity efforts," claims Christie.

In addition, studies have actually shown that creatine can speed up healing by decreasing inflammation and boosting glycogen storage in muscle mass. Because intense exercise diminishes shops of glycogenyour body's main source of energyrebuilding these shops swiftly advertises healing. In one more study, creatine was revealed to improve performance during durations of enhanced training intensity that might otherwise result in overtraining.


In the hundreds of researches performed on creatine over the years, the only considerable side effect that's been reported is a little amount of weight gain.
